Abstract :
The authors attempt to provide a set of benchmarks for GUI (graphical user interface) applications developed under the X Window System, by proposing a method of classifying the GUI characteristics into classes based on a measure of graphical complexity. They conducted data gathering experiments on sample X applications from each GUI class measuring resource usage. The data were compiled, and the results are compared against the proposed classes to make some projections about how X based GUI applications may consume resources. The method of gathering data about the applications is presented
